Role description
Job Summary
Our client is seeking a Data Engineer to join their team! This position is located in Blue Ash, Ohio.
Duties
• Design, build, and maintain robust, scalable ELT/ETL pipelines and data transformations using Databricks, Spark, and Synapse
• Model high-volume, complex event-level datasets to support dashboards, experimentation, ML models, and marketing activation
• Enforce data governance, discoverability, and stewardship, ensuring compliance and lineage tracking
• Validate and reconcile data pipelines against established behavioral datasets
• Partner with data architects, analysts, data scientists, and marketing teams to deliver trusted, reusable, and well-structured datasets that power dashboards and decision-making
• Mature the data ingestion, processing, orchestration, and curation capabilities
• Participate in agile delivery processes: sprint planning, backlog refinement, documentation, collaborating through Jira and Confluence
• Document data assets, transformations, and pipelines for discoverability, transparency, and long-term maintainability
• Facilitate clear and continuous communication between business and engineering teams
Desired Skills/Experience:
• 7+ years of experience in data engineering or similar roles, with hands-on delivery of cloud-based data solutions
• Microsoft Certified: Azure Data Engineer Associate and Databricks: Databricks Certified Data Engineer Professional
• Strong expertise in Databricks and Azure Synapse, with practical experience in Spark-based data processing
• Proficient in modern data architectures
• Advanced SQL skills for data transformation and performance optimization
• Proven ability to model and manage large-scale, complex behavioral and Ecommerce datasets
• Expert in BI and best practices for data enablement and self-service analytics
• Working knowledge of behavioral analytics platforms
• Excellent communication skills with a talent for translating technical concepts into business value
• Experience operating in agile delivery environments, balancing speed, scalability, and solution quality
• Proven leadership as a technical lead
Benefits:
• Medical, Dental, & Vision Insurance Plans
• Employee-Owned Profit Sharing (ESOP)
• 401K offered
The approximate pay range for this position is between $64.00 and $84.00. Please note that the pay range provided is a good faith estimate. Final compensation may vary based on factors including but not limited to background, knowledge, skills, and location. We comply with local wage minimums.
